What are the Different Stages of a Mother-Son Relationship?

The mother-son relationship evolves through several distinct stages, each marked by unique challenges and rewards.

  • Infancy and Early Childhood: This period is characterized by intense physical closeness and nurturing. The mother provides the foundation of security and emotional well-being for her son.

  • Childhood and Adolescence: As the son grows, the relationship evolves to incorporate independence and exploration. The mother's role shifts from primary caregiver to supportive guide, navigating the complexities of adolescence together.

  • Adulthood: This stage marks a transition to a more peer-like relationship, characterized by mutual respect and ongoing support. The mother-son bond remains a source of strength and comfort throughout life's challenges.

How Do Mothers Influence Their Sons' Lives?

A mother's influence on her son's life is profound and far-reaching. She shapes his:

  • Emotional Intelligence: Mothers play a crucial role in helping their sons develop emotional intelligence, teaching them to understand and manage their feelings.

  • Self-Esteem: A mother's unconditional love and support are foundational to a son's self-esteem and confidence.

  • Relationships: The relationship a son has with his mother often serves as a template for his future relationships with other women.

  • Sense of Identity: A mother's influence helps shape her son's sense of self, guiding him in understanding his strengths and weaknesses.

What are Some Challenges in a Mother-Son Relationship?

While the mother-son bond is often strong and loving, it can also face challenges:

  • Differing Expectations: Mismatched expectations can cause conflict, particularly during adolescence and young adulthood.

  • Communication Barriers: Open and honest communication is vital for a healthy relationship, but communication breakdowns can occur.

  • Emotional Distance: In some cases, emotional distance can develop, creating feelings of isolation and disconnect.
